摘要
在对固体火箭冲压发动机的高度特性进行分析的基础上,分别研究了壅塞式和非壅塞式固体火箭冲压发动机性能调节特性及方案,并着重分析了非壅塞式固体火箭冲压发动机的燃气流量自适应调节原理与规律。分析计算表明:非壅塞式固体火箭冲压发动机不仅结构简单,且能明显提高发动机在非设计状态时的性能。
Based on the attentive analysis of the altitude characteristic of solid fuel ramrocket,the performance adjustment method for choked and unchoked solid fuel ramrocket is studied respectively.The principle for adaptive adjustment of fuel gas in unchoked solid fuel ramrocket is analyzed attentively.The research indicates that the structure of the unchoked solid fuel ramrocket is very simple and the performance of the engine is very high even at nondesigned point.
